This Planned Procurement Notice is issued to inform the market that University Hospitals Dorset NHS Foundation Trust intends to use the Crown Commercial Service RM6313 Demand Management & Renewables DPS to procure a source of geothermal energy early 2026, and to bring it to the markets attention that at this time a number of NHS Trusts across UK-England also intend to bring forward a programme of approximately 5–20 potential geothermal projects through the Crown Commercial Service RM6313 Demand Management & Renewables DPS over the coming 24 months.

University Hospitals Dorset NHS Foundation Trust is publishing this PPN to signal its own intended use of the DPS and, for supplier awareness and to provide early market visibility of the anticipated wider national pipeline of projects that may be brought forward independently by other NHS Trusts across England.

Estimated contract value of the University Hospitals Dorset NHS Foundation Trust is: Up to £25,000,000 (ex VAT).

For supplier awareness only, the wider national pipeline of geothermal projects that other NHS Trusts may bring forward could represent a multiple of this sum dependent on the number of installations procured, possibly up to an estimated combined value of £350,000,000 (ex VAT). University Hospitals Dorset NHS Foundation Trust has no responsibility for, and makes no commitment regarding, any procurement undertaken by other Trusts.

Each NHS Trust will conduct its own specific procurement as and when appropriate.

The programme is being coordinated with procurement administration support from the Carbon and Energy Fund (CEF). Each NHS Trust will launch its own individual Crown Commercial Service RM6313 DPS Further Competition and award its own contract.

The purpose of this notice is solely to:

  • raise early market awareness of expected geothermal procurements;
  • encourage capable suppliers to apply to join RM6313 in advance to enable them to participate; and
  • support strong competition and supplier preparedness.

No documents, or technical information will be issued at this stage.

Please note the deadline for responses to this PPN is set to 31st March 2026, this is to attract as many supplier registrations as possible to the CCS RM6313 framework to be eligible to participate in future tender activities.

The initial call off competitions will commence early February, and we encourage potential bidders to engage and register as early as possible to be included in the first tranche of tender activity.

This notice does not commit University Hospitals Dorset NHS Foundation Trust to any procurement activity. University Hospitals Dorset NHS Foundation Trust takes no responsibility for any further competition or procurement activity undertaken by other NHS Trusts.
